Corporate News 9-11-2012

Steel Authority of India Ltd reported a 12% rise in net profit during the second quarter of 2012-13 fiscal against the same period previous year.


Kingfisher Airlines reported a net loss of Rs 754 crore for the July-September quarter, a sharp increase from Rs 469 crore in the year-ago period, and said it is working on a plan to resume services.

Sun Pharmaceutical Industries reported a 46.5% drop in quarterly net profit after it set aside Rs 584 crore towards a possible compensation in a patent dispute case related to drug Protonix.

Ipca Laboratories has said that there will be no finished drug exports from its Madhya Pradesh plant to the US, till it resolves certain “non-conformances” that it noticed and referred to the US regulatory authority.

GVK Power & infrastructure Ltd has entered into an agreement for the operation, management and development of commercial facilities at Denpasar International Airport, Bali, Indonesia.
